一聚教程网:一个值得你收藏的教程网站

最新下载

热门教程

区块链安全靠什么守护-核心机制大揭秘

时间:2025-12-27 19:30:02 编辑:袖梨 来源:一聚教程网

区块链技术通过密码学算法、分布式共识机制与链式数据结构构建了独特的安全体系。本文将详细解析哈希加密公私钥体系共识算法三大核心安全机制,帮助读者理解区块链如何实现去中心化环境下的数据可靠性。

区块链不可篡改的技术原理

哈希函数的防篡改特性

区块链采用哈希函数将交易数据转化为固定长度的数字指纹。每个新区块都包含前一个区块的哈希值,形成紧密链接的数据链条。任何数据改动都会导致哈希值剧烈变化,攻击者必须同时修改后续所有区块才能实现篡改,这在大型网络中几乎不可能实现。

比特币网络使用的SHA-256算法具备单向计算特性,原始数据无法从哈希值反向推导。全网节点通过比对哈希值验证数据完整性,确保上链信息永久可信。

非对称加密的资产保护

区块链采用公私钥加密体系验证交易所有权。私钥用于生成数字签名,公钥则用于验证签名有效性。这种机制确保只有资产持有者才能发起合法交易,从根本上杜绝伪造转账的可能性。

346464.jpeg

分布式共识机制解析

共识算法的核心作用

区块链网络通过共识算法实现节点间的账本同步。工作量证明要求矿工消耗计算资源竞争记账权,权益证明则根据代币持有量分配验证权限。这些机制确保恶意节点难以控制网络,必须付出远高于正常维护的经济成本。

拜占庭容错机制

区块链网络允许部分节点出现故障或恶意行为,只要多数节点保持诚实,系统就能维持正常运转。这种容错能力源自分布式账本的冗余设计,每个节点都保存完整交易记录,单点故障不会影响整体数据安全。

经济激励与安全协同

密码经济学设计

区块链将经济激励融入协议设计,使节点维护网络安全能获得代币奖励。这种机制促使参与者自发遵守规则,因为破坏网络的成本远高于诚实参与的收益,有效抑制了51%攻击等恶意行为。

防御集中化攻击

通过算法动态调整哇旷难度和奖励分配,区块链协议能防止算力或权益过度集中。网络规模的扩大进一步提高了攻击门槛,使控制多数资源变得不切实际。

用户端安全实践

密钥管理规范

硬件签报和多重签名技术能有效保护用户私钥。冷存储方案将私钥隔离在离线环境,大幅降低被黑客窃取的风险。定期备份助记词也是防止资产丢失的重要措施。

网络防护升级

区块链协议通过持续迭代修复潜在漏洞。节点间的通信采用端到端加密,防止交易数据在传输过程被篡改。社区驱动的安全审计帮助发现并修复系统弱点。

生态协作与安全演进

开源审查机制

区块链代码开源特性允许全球开发者共同审查。这种透明机制能快速发现潜在漏洞,通过社区提案和治理投票实现协议的安全升级。

多方监督体系

用户、开发者和节点运营商构成多层次监督网络。异常交易会被节点自动拒绝,重大安全事件将触发社区紧急响应,形成动态防护体系。

以上就是小编为大家带来的区块链安全机制深度解析,如需获取更多技术科普内容,请持续关注本站。

热门栏目